How the VL53L0X Works
The VL53L0X uses Time-of-Flight technology to determine the distance between the sensor and an object.
The sensor emits an infrared laser pulse toward the target. When the light reflects from the object and returns to the sensor, the device measures the flight time of the light. The onboard processing then provides a digital distance measurement that can be read by a connected microcontroller through the I2C interface.
Because the sensor measures the flight time of light rather than relying on traditional reflective intensity measurements, it can provide useful distance information across different types of targets and lighting conditions.

Common Pin Connections
Depending on the breakout-board version, the module may provide pins such as:
- VIN/VCC – Power input
- GND – Ground
- SDA – I2C data
- SCL – I2C clock
- XSHUT – Shutdown/control pin on supported boards
- GPIO1 – Optional interrupt/output pin on supported boards
Pin names and available pins can vary by manufacturer, so check the module’s labeling and documentation before wiring.
